An award-winning Westmeath café says the cost of doing business is the equivalent of death by a thousand cuts.
Beans and Leaves Café in Athlone was named this year's most Dog Friendly Venue at the Ruby Heart Awards earlier this month.
However, owner and Head Chef Steven Linehan says the business is battling against increasing energy bills, wage pressure, and supply chain cost inflation.
